A'''''Darken''''' is a ''[[Dungeons and Dragons]]''-based webcomicweb comic that stands out from many like it in that it follows an evil group. An evil group who knows they are evil and glory in it. An evil group who knows it, glories in it, and are total [[Badass|Badasses]]es too.
 
In fact, the story begins with a knight named Gort discovering that when making a [[Deal Withwith the Devil]], usually you aren't going to get away with a double-cross. Not one to take death lying down, he rapidly returns [[Like a Badass Out of Hell]]. Gathering up his [[True Companions]] (the ones he hasn't killed yet), he embarks on his quest for [[A God Am I|invincibility]]. Too bad several members of his group have their own motivations. Not to mention the [[Evil Twin]] (which would be good in this case). Add in Gort's old rival returning [[Like a Badass Out of Hell|Like A Badass Out Ofof Heaven]] and you begin to get an idea of the plot.
 
The second major arc is about the war against "The Worm Lord", who starts as a disturbing rumor before becoming a tangible enemy.

Well written and well drawn, with a quality that increases with time. You can see the starting page [http://darkencomic.com/?webcomic_post=20031216 here]. It is now finished.
 
The artist has started another webcomicweb comic called [[Widdershins (Webcomic)|Widdershins]]
